F. Scott Fitzgerald, the messenger of a lost generation, paints a portrait of the era between the two wars in this collection of eleven stories: hedonism that bites, moral decay that intoxicates, and youth that burns like fireworks.
Collections of short stories from Roman life in the post-war era: ordinary people from the people and the petty bourgeoisie – the poor, workers, small craftsmen – face misery, survival, jealousy, petty deceit and moral compromises in everyday life.
The collection leaves an impression of melancholy, but also of the quiet beauty of everyday life.
The collection "Spring in Badrovac" (published in Belgrade in 1955 by Prosveta, reprinted in Zagreb by SKD Prosvjeta in 2019) brings together short stories written by Desnica in the 1950s, focused on a Dalmatian village in post-war chaos.
Ova knjiga sadrži narativno delo velikog ruskog pisca, A. P. Čehova, iz godina 1888-1892. U njoj se više nećemo susresti sa malim humorističkim pričama kojima je „Antoša Čehonte“ briljantno započeo svoju karijeru u humorističkim časopisima.
